Raymond James Financial, founded in 1962 and headquartered in Saint Petersburg, Florida, is a comprehensive financial services firm that offers investment banking and wealth management advisory services to individuals, corporations, and municipalities. The firm provides a wide range of solutions, including financial planning, insurance, and investment services. In investment banking, Raymond James specializes in mergers and acquisitions, public offerings, activism response, debt origination, and restructuring, serving various sectors such as technology, healthcare, energy, and real estate. The firm is recognized for its client-centric approach and has successfully facilitated numerous transactions, establishing a reputation for delivering independent solutions that create long-term value for its clients.

North American Energy Partners
Post in 2025
North American Energy Partners Inc. (NAEPI) provides a range of heavy construction and mining and pipeline installation services to customers in the Canadian oil sands, industrial construction, commercial and public construction and pipeline construction markets. The Company’s primary market is the Canadian oil sands, where it supports the customers’ mining operations and capital projects. NAEPI provides services through all stages of an oil sands project’s lifecycle, its core focus is on providing recurring services, such as contract mining, during the operational phase. During the fiscal year ended March 31, 2012 (fiscal 2012), recurring services represented 87% of the oil sands business. The Company’s business segments include heavy construction and mining and pipeline. In July 2013, the Company announced that it has completed sale of its Piling businesses to Keller Group plc.

Kraken Robotics
Post in 2021
Kraken Robotics is a marine technology company engaged in the design, development, and marketing of advanced sonar and acoustic velocity sensors for Unmanned Underwater Vehicles used in military and commercial applications. Over the last two years, the company has earned a reputation as world leaders in Synthetic Aperture Sonar - a revolutionary underwater imaging technology that dramatically improves seabed surveys by providing ultra-high resolution imagery at superior coverage rates. Kraken’s series of SAS products called AquaPix® leverages nearly two decades of R&D conducted by NATO’s Undersea Research Centre and millions of dollars in funding support from NATO government sponsors. AquaPix® offers comparable performance to existing high-end military systems at less than 20% of the cost. Kraken is currently engaged in various stages of technology validation and teaming agreements with leading laboratories and strategic industry partners including Defence Research and Development Canada, U.S. Navy’s Naval Sea Systems Command (NAVSEA); the UK Ministry of Defence; Northrop Grumman; ECA Robotics and others. Kraken is located in beautiful, Conception Bay South, Newfoundland.
Greenlane Renewables
Post in 2021
Greenlane Renewables is a leading provider of biogas upgrading systems, specializing in the production of renewable natural gas (RNG) from various organic waste sources such as landfills, wastewater treatment plants, dairy farms, and food waste. The company's technology effectively removes impurities and separates carbon dioxide from raw biogas, converting it into clean RNG that can be injected into the natural gas grid or used directly as vehicle fuel. Greenlane's solutions are marketed under the Greenlane Biogas brand and are designed to assist waste producers, gas utilities, and project developers in transforming low-value biogas into a high-value, low-carbon renewable resource. The company operates in multiple regions, including Canada, Brazil, Europe, and the United States, generating revenue through system sales and aftercare services.

Tetra Bio-Pharma
Post in 2020
Tetra Bio-Pharma Inc. is a biopharmaceutical company dedicated to the development of cannabinoid-based medicines. Headquartered in Orleans, Canada, the company is focused on creating prescription drugs for conditions such as chronic pain and cancer-related symptoms. Its clinical pipeline includes several products: SERENITY for cancer cachexia and REBORN for breakthrough pain, both in phase 2 trials, as well as PLENITUDE for advanced cancer pain and PPP003 for painful dry eye and uveitis, currently in phase 1. Additionally, Tetra is developing HCC011 for hepatocellular carcinoma. The company emphasizes the integration of traditional medicinal cannabis use with scientific validation and safety data to meet regulatory standards. Tetra Bio-Pharma has established collaboration agreements with various organizations, including Aphria Inc. and the University of New Brunswick, and has a co-development partnership with Storz & Bickel for fibromyalgia treatment. The company was previously known as GrowPros Cannabis Ventures Inc. before rebranding in September 2016.

Orezone Resources
Post in 2020
Orezone Gold Corporation (ORE:TSX) is a Canadian exploration and development company with a gold discovery track record of +12 Moz and recent mine development experience in Burkina Faso, West Africa. The Company owns a 100% interest in Bomboré, the largest undeveloped oxide gold deposit in West Africa that can be developed in phases to reduce capital expenditure requirements. The deposit is situated 85 km east of the capital city, adjacent to an international highway. The Company announced the highlights of its NI 43-101 Compliant Bomboré Feasibility Study in April 2015 and submitted its application for a mining permit in May 2015. Pending permitting and full project financing, production could commence as early as the end of 2017. The Company's mission is to create wealth for its stakeholders by discovering and mining the earth's resources in an efficient, responsible manner.

Orla Mining
Post in 2018
Orla Mining conducts advanced gold and silver open-pit and heap leach project. Orla is developing the Camino Rojo Oxide Gold Project located in Zacatecas State, Central Mexico. The project is 100% owned by Orla and covers over 200,000 hectares. Estimated Mineral Reserves as of June 24, 2019, are 44.0 million tonnes at a gold grade of 0.73 grams per tonne (“g/t”) and a silver grade of 14.2 g/t, for total mineral reserves of 1.03 million ounces of gold and 20.1 million ounces of silver. The company is headquartered in Vancouver, British Columbia.

Morgan Keegan
Acquisition in 2012
Morgan Keegan is a prominent full-service investment firm based in Memphis, Tennessee, established in 1969 by Allen Morgan, Jr. It operates more than 145 offices across 15 states and Canada, serving individual and institutional clients both in the Southern United States and internationally. The firm specializes in wealth management services, which encompass a private client group, equity and fixed-income capital markets, and investment banking. In 2001, Morgan Keegan was acquired by Regions Financial Corporation and later became a wholly owned subsidiary of Raymond James. With a workforce exceeding 2,700 employees and significant equity capital, Morgan Keegan has established itself as a leading player in the financial services industry, aiming to deliver high-quality service and achieve recognition as the premier investment firm in the region.
Labrador Iron Mines
Post in 2012
Labrador Iron Mines is a mineral resource company focused on mining iron ore and exploring direct shipping iron ore projects in the Labrador Trough region, primarily near Schefferville, Quebec. The company's key assets include the James Mine, adjacent deposits, and the Silver Yards processing facility, along with the Houston property, which encompasses the Malcolm 1 deposit. These projects are connected to the Port of Sept-Iles by a direct railway and are supported by established infrastructure, including local transportation and power services. The Schefferville Projects consist of 20 distinct iron ore deposits, originally part of the Iron Ore Company of Canada's operations from 1954 to 1982, which are associated with significant historical reserves. Since commencing production in 2011, Labrador Iron Mines has sold 3.6 million dry tonnes of iron ore, primarily to the Chinese market. However, the company suspended operations in 2014 due to low iron ore prices and is currently focused on securing financing, restructuring debt, and preparing for future development of the Houston Mine when market conditions improve.

Enablence Technologies
Post in 2010
Enablence Technologies Inc. designs, manufactures, and sells integrated optical components and subsystems for various markets, including telecommunications, aerospace, and bio-chemical sensing. The company's product offerings include transmit optical sub-assemblies, receive optical sub-assemblies, arrayed waveguide gratings, multicast switches, and optical splitters, which are essential for fiber-optic networks across access, metro, and long-haul applications. Enablence also operates a planar lightwave circuit (PLC) foundry in Fremont, California, producing silica-on-silicon and polymer PLC chips utilized in dense wavelength division multiplexing and other optical devices. The company has expanded its technology portfolio to include advanced 100G transceivers, catering to emerging markets like medical devices and automotive LiDAR. Enablence has a joint venture in China for mass production of PLC splitter chips aimed at the Fiber-to-the-Home market. Its advanced technology center in Ottawa specializes in hybrid integration of optical devices, contributing to the development of photonic integrated circuits for high-performance applications.
